Question

My mother has alhimers we live in NY she has about $10,000 and recieves $1,200 a month pension she 87 we re told she has to much money for medicaid and the state to put her in a nursing home and not enough money to pay for one.Is there anything someone can do? She is very nasty and dont know what she ll do next

Answer

Thanks for your question.She can enter as private pay here and then they will allow her to spend down and go on medicaid.This is realistically her only option.You may be able to spend down on prepaid funeral including plot/marker and also pay any medical bills she has outstanding here.

But she would be eligible here after spend down.That covers resources.If her income is too much see about here resending her pension here.Many plans allow folks to reduce for eligibilty here.Contact the plan and ask.

Your ME--medicaid eleigibiltiy worker can guide you in the process and give you the limits to shoot for here.You need to be real careful here and not sign any financial guarantees or any kind with nursing home.Make sure only she is liable here for her care.

Should we get alawyer or do it ourself

Accepted Answer

To me if you will contact the NE worker here and get good information about where exactly she is high you can do the spend down.Resources are real easy--you just ask for a list of things you can spend it on to make her eligible.

The pension here if it too much is harder to get reduced. But a lawyer here can't really help you that much.She is past the age where say she could stash something in trust like the cash..But really the ME worker would give you limits on funeral planning.And I deal in elder law alot.

I will tell you that statistically she won't be in the nursing home all that long .90% of nursing home patients live there 5 years or less.By the time they truly qualify here they have enough medical problems they don't live that much longer.
